The Half Way Home

Philemon run the only half-way home in Kenya, accommodating up to ten residents on a six month program. To date, over seventy released prisoners have been reconciled to their families and communities after passing through the Home. The Home is split into male and female quarters. It houses 4 bedrooms, 2 kitchens, an office and a prayer room / common area.
 
Productive lives
 
Residents learn skills such as carpentry, metalwork and tailoring in the social enterprise businesses of Philemon. Philemon practically assists residents to go on and find employment, for example, by helping residents to obtain ID cards. Residents are also encouraged to participate in secondments, such as to the National Probation Service.

Micro-Enterprise and Aftercare
 
Philemon endeavours to keep in close touch with ex-residents and, where possible, provides start-up loans and grants for residents to set-up small businesses upon leaving the home.
